What is a Plex Media Server?
A Plex media server is a powerful tool for managing and streaming your media library. It allows you to organize your movies, TV shows, and music, and stream them to various devices. Meanwhile, it also provides features like metadata tagging and automatic content updating. Additionally, Plex supports a wide range of devices, including smartphones, tablets, and smart TVs.

Challenges of Hosting a Plex Media Server
While hosting a Plex media server offers many benefits, there are also some challenges to consider. For instance, it requires a significant amount of storage space and processing power. Additionally, it can be complex to set up and configure, especially for those without technical expertise. However, with the right guidance and support, these challenges can be overcome.
